2006?

Impossible to say right now....really, impossible.

Dual-core AMD64s, "Cell" CPUs, DDR3 system memory, RDRAM (yellowstone) systems, ATIs version of SLI, or SLI, SATA2....all these things are coming....and then some.

When talking about tech, one can only put together a speculative system and even then, it may not pan out.
